Sensible Life wants to provide readers with some reputable merchants to do business with online this holiday season. While we are not guaranteeing the reliability, or promoting these merchants as being the best, we are sharing our experiences so shoppers can make informed decisions. Last season, staff at Sensible Life had pretty bad experiences with www.buy.com and www.dvddonkey.com. Buy.com was even rude when calling for assistance, and with each of these vendors, merchandise was ordered two month ahead of time, with one item not arriving at all, and the other two days before Christmas –after we had purchased a replacement gift because we could not find status that would ensure merchandise delivery before December 25th.
Below are merchants that we have found reliable, with merchandise of good quality, and helpful customer service the majority of our transactions.

Whenever ordering from these merchants, be sure to do a search for discount codes. Even though most of these have reasonable pricing, you may get discounts by using the code offered. Sometimes it’s 10% off your entire order, or 40% off one item, free shipping, deferred billing, and other options.
